Discutir métodos de desarrollo de productos.

Los métodos discutidos en el desarrollo de productos incluyen el modelo en cascada, el análisis de requisitos, la fase de diseño, la planificación y descomposición de tareas, el desarrollo iterativo a corto plazo, la integración continua y las pruebas automatizadas, etc.

1. Modelo en cascada

El modelo en cascada es un método de desarrollo de productos secuencial lineal. El modelo en cascada enfatiza la secuencia lineal de cada etapa y la entrega clara de las etapas, pero su desventaja es su falta de flexibilidad y dificultad para responder a los requisitos o cambios de diseño.

2. Análisis de requisitos

Aclarar los objetivos y funciones del producto y convertirlos en requisitos claros. Esta etapa requiere comunicarse con las partes interesadas y garantizar una comprensión clara de los requisitos del producto.

3. Etapa de diseño

En función de las necesidades, se realiza el diseño del producto y la planificación de la arquitectura, y se determinan las tecnologías y recursos necesarios. Esto incluye el diseño de hardware y software, diseño de interfaces y modelado de sistemas o componentes.

4. Descomposición del plan y tareas

Desarrollar un plan y cronograma básico para el desarrollo de productos y descomponerlo en tareas e historias de usuario (requisitos) pequeñas y manejables.

5. Desarrollo iterativo a corto plazo

Divida el ciclo de desarrollo en iteraciones a corto plazo, generalmente de 2 a 4 semanas, y en cada iteración se construye, prueba y se entrega un incremento de producto utilizable. Traduzca conocimientos y datos en preguntas y desafíos específicos de los usuarios para aclarar la dirección y los objetivos del desarrollo de productos.

6. Integración continua y pruebas automatizadas

Asegurar el progreso y la calidad del desarrollo a través de la integración continua y las pruebas automatizadas. Adopte un enfoque de innovación centrado en el usuario y aborde el desarrollo de productos de una manera creativa y resolutiva a través de una comprensión profunda de las necesidades y los puntos débiles del usuario.